About Starkville, Colorado

Starkville is a locality in Las Animas County, Colorado, United States. It is a small community with a population of 102. The population density is 70.6 people per km². Starkville is located at 37.1153°N, 104.5242°W. It observes the Mountain Time (America/Denver) timezone. ZIP code: 81082.

Starkville lies cradled by a landscape that shifts dramatically from the vast, sun-bleached plains to the jagged embrace of the Front Range. It lies 78.8 miles south of Pueblo, CO (from Pueblo, CO: bearing 177°T), and is situated 4.0 miles south-southwest of Trinidad.
